I might approach this with the Russian ladies by focusing on cardio
respiratory changes after birth. They may be familiar with hypothermia
concepts as well, and the fact that one can be warmed up more quickly next
to a warm body rather than wrapped in a blanket. You could also talk about
babies immune system being exposed to the mom the first day to be
colonized. I would initially approach this for the first couple of hours
after birth and maybe then extended to the first 24 hours. I would offer it
as new science and for the benefit of the baby's health and not necessarily
related to the breastfeeding?
